About IBEW local 53
Local 53 of the International Brotherhood of Electrical Workers serves roughly 2500 men and women working in the greater Kansas City area and the western half of Missouri. Chartered in 1917, we represent outside construction line workers, line clearance/tree trimming, utilities, municipalities, REA cooperatives, power plants, radio and television.
